About Barrack Heights 2528

The size of Barrack Heights is approximately 2.4 square kilometres. There are 12 parks, covering nearly 13.1% of the total area. The population of Barrack Heights in 2016 was 5900 people. By 2021 the population was 6003 showing a population growth of 1.8%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Barrack Heights is 10-19 years. Households in Barrack Heights are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Barrack Heights work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 64.70% of the homes in Barrack Heights were owner-occupied compared with 64.50% in 2016.

Barrack Heights has 2,717 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Barrack Heights have seen a 35.91%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 43.21% increase. As at 31 July 2026:

  • The median value for Houses in Barrack Heights is $900,668 while the median value for Units is $569,935.
  • Houses have a median rent of $690 while Units have a median rent of $550.
There are currently 11 properties listed for sale, and 5 properties listed for rent in Barrack heights on OnTheHouse. According to Cotality's data, 98 properties were sold in the past 12 months in Barrack heights.
